Precautions for safety

The manufacturer shall not assume any liability for the damage
caused by not observing the description of this manual.
WARNING
General
• Before starting to install the air conditioner, read carefully
through the Installation Manual, and follow its instructions to
install the air conditioner.
• Only a qualifi ed installer(*1) or qualifi ed service person(*1) is
allowed to install the air conditioner. If the air conditioner is
installed by an unqualifi ed individual, a fi re, electric shocks,
injury, water leakage, noise and/or vibration may result.
• Do not use any refrigerant different from the one specifi ed for
complement or replacement. Otherwise, abnormally high
pressure may be generated in the refrigeration cycle, which
may result in a failure or explosion of the product or an injury to
your body.
• When transporting the air conditioner, use a forklift and when
moving the air conditioner by hand, move the unit with 4 people.
• Before opening the intake grille of the indoor unit or service
panel of the outdoor unit, set the circuit breaker to the OFF
position. Failure to set the circuit breaker to the OFF position
may result in electric shocks through contact with the interior
parts. Only a qualifi ed installer(*1) or qualifi ed service person(*1)
is allowed to remove the intake grille of the indoor unit or service
panel of the outdoor unit and do the work required.
• Before carrying out the installation, maintenance, repair or
removal work, be sure to set the circuit breaker to the OFF
position. Otherwise, electric shocks may result.
• Place a "Work in progress" sign near the circuit breaker while
the installation, maintenance, repair or removal work is being
carried out. There is a danger of electric shocks if the circuit
breaker is set to ON by mistake.
• Only a qualifi ed installer(*1) or qualifi ed service person(*1) is
allowed to undertake work at heights using a stand of 50 cm or
more.

• Wear protective gloves and safety work clothing during
installation, servicing and removal.
• Do not touch the aluminum fi n of the outdoor unit. You may
injure yourself if you do so. If the fi n must be touched for some
reason, fi rst put on protective gloves and safety work clothing,
and then proceed.
• Do not climb onto or place objects on top of the outdoor unit.
You may fall or the objects may fall off of the outdoor unit and
result in injury.
• When working at heights, use a ladder which complies with the
ISO 14122 standard, and follow the procedure in the ladder's
instructions. Also wear a helmet for use in industry as protective
gear to undertake the work.
• When cleaning the fi lter or other parts of the outdoor unit, set
the circuit breaker to OFF without fail, and place a "Work in
progress" sign near the circuit breaker before proceeding with
the work.
• When working at heights, put a sign in place so that no-one will
approach the work location, before proceeding with the work.
Parts and other objects may fall from above, possibly injuring a
person below.
• You shall ensure that the air conditioner is transported in stable
condition. If any part of the product is broken, contact the
dealer.
• Do not modify the products. Do not also disassemble or modify
the parts. It may cause a fi re, electric shock or injury.
• This appliance is intended to be used by expert or trained users
in shops, in light industry, or for commercial use by lay persons.
• Do not add any other devices without factory advice.
About the refrigerant
• This product contains fl uorinated greenhouse gases.
• Do not vent gases to the atmosphere.
• The appliance shall be stored in a room without continuously
operating ignition sources (for example: open fl ames, an
operating gas appliance or an operating electric heater).
• Do not pierce or burn refrigerant cycle parts.
• Do not use means to accelerate the defrosting process or to
clean, other than those recommended by the manufacturer.
• Be aware that refrigerants may not contain an odour.
